Uploaded image for project: 'Qt'
  1. Qt
  2. QTBUG-60411

qbytearray.h:443:5: error: ‘QByteArray::operator QNoImplicitBoolCast() const’ is private

    XMLWordPrintable

Details

    • c3e8fc1038e1929f28880c4aff58f6a0c9db1cfd

    Description

      https://codereview.qt-project.org/#/c/192636/
      https://testresults.qt.io/coin/integration/qt/qt5/tasks/1493180277
      https://testresults.qt.io/coin/api/results/qt/qtdeclarative/d0b0c909e31d8128e63384fbb439037b2d62522f/LinuxopenSUSE_42_1x86_64LinuxopenSUSE_42_1x86_64GCCqtci-linux-openSUSE-42.1-x86_64-3768c5DeveloperBuild_NoPch/7efacf3e9382d6c73499805fef6da87a401b4447/build_1493180413/buildlog.txt.gz

      In file included from /home/qt/work/install/include/QtCore/QByteArray:1:0,
                       from scenegraph/coreapi/qsgshaderrewriter.cpp:40:
      /home/qt/work/install/include/QtCore/qbytearray.h: In function ‘QByteArray qsgShaderRewriter_insertZAttributes(const char*, QSurfaceFormat::OpenGLContextProfile)’:
      /home/qt/work/install/include/QtCore/qbytearray.h:443:5: error: ‘QByteArray::operator QNoImplicitBoolCast() const’ is private
           operator QNoImplicitBoolCast() const;
           ^
      scenegraph/coreapi/qsgshaderrewriter.cpp:219:27: error: within this context
                               + "    gl_Position.z = (gl_Position.z * _qt_zRange + _qt_order) * gl_Position.w;\n"
                                 ^
      In file included from /home/qt/work/install/include/QtCore/QByteArray:1:0,
                       from scenegraph/coreapi/qsgshaderrewriter.cpp:40:
      /home/qt/work/install/include/QtCore/qbytearray.h:443:5: error: ‘QByteArray::operator QNoImplicitBoolCast() const’ is private
           operator QNoImplicitBoolCast() const;
           ^
      scenegraph/coreapi/qsgshaderrewriter.cpp:220:49: error: within this context
                               + QByteArray(tok.pos - 1);
                                                       ^
      Makefile:37334: recipe for target '.obj/qsgshaderrewriter.o' failed
      make[2]: *** [.obj/qsgshaderrewriter.o] Error 1
      make[2]: *** Waiting for unfinished jobs....
      make[2]: Leaving directory '/home/qt/work/qt/qtdeclarative/src/quick'
      Makefile:95: recipe for target 'sub-quick-make_first-ordered' failed
      make[1]: *** [sub-quick-make_first-ordered] Error 2
      make[1]: Leaving directory '/home/qt/work/qt/qtdeclarative/src'
      Makefile:47: recipe for target 'sub-src-make_first' failed
      make: *** [sub-src-make_first] Error 2
      

      Failed in Linux openSUSE_42_1 (gcc-x86_64), Windows 7 (mingw53-x86) and OS X 10.10 (clang-x86_64), OS X 10.11 (clang-x86_64)

      Attachments

        For Gerrit Dashboard: QTBUG-60411
        # Subject Branch Project Status CR V

        Activity

          People

            liaqi Liang Qi
            liaqi Liang Qi
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Gerrit Reviews

                There are no open Gerrit changes